- The distance between Santuck, Sc, Usa and Aberystwyth, Wales, Uk is approximately 6,230 km or 3,871 mi.
- To reach Santuck, Sc in this distance one would set out from Aberystwyth, Wales bearing 285°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Santuck, Sc bearing 226° or SW .
- Santuck, Sc has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Aberystwyth, Wales has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Santuck, Sc is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Aberystwyth, Wales is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 6.7 °C (12.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.4 °C (18.7°F) more in Santuck, Sc.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 165.8 mm (6.5 in) more which is equivalent to 165.8 l/m² (4.07 US gal/ft²) or 1,658,000 l/ha (177,251 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.4° higher in Santuck, Sc than in Aberystwyth, Wales.
